Folded Plates are connected to in such a way that the structuralsystem is capable of carrying loads without the need of additional supporting beams along mutual edges. The first Roof which was constructed using folded structure was prepared by the engineer eudene Freyssinet in 1923 as an aircraft hangar at Orly airport in Paris.

Kiley’s landscape plan, installed on the ground floor of the 49-m (160-ft) atrium, is driven by the 4-m (13-ft) grade change between the 42nd and 43rd Street building entrances. The primary staircase connecting these entrances is broken into three sections, the landings of which access tiered garden terraces at three levels.
